Overview

Makes Windows-style paths more unix and URI friendly. Useful if you work with paths that eventually will be used in URLs.

var urix = require("urix")

// On Windows:
urix("c:\\users\\you\\foo")
// /users/you/foo

// On unix-like systems:
urix("c:\\users\\you\\foo")
// c:\users\you\foo

Installation

npm install urix

var urix = require("urix")

Usage

urix(path)

On Windows, replaces all backslashes with slashes and uses a slash instead of a drive letter and a colon for absolute paths.

On unix-like systems it is a no-op.
